Коротко - с системно-поддерживаемыми файлами. (Ну, не знаю, как сказать иначе, вообщем, с теми файлами, которые изначально ассоциированы с системными примочками и которые она просто так не отдает) можно апоступить так:
Надо удалить параметр
LegacyDisable
В ключе реестра:
HKCR\[FileType]\shell\[verb]
И так же параметр
CLSID
В ключе реестра:
HKCR\[FileType]\shell\[verb]\ DropTarget
Где у нас
FileType - тип файла (не расширение!) например для
*.AVI -
AVIFile
Verb - действие, например
open или
play
Без этих действий у меня LA не хотел проигрывать нужные типы файлов (инсталлятор был перепакованный, свойский)
На счет остального - сейчас некогда собирать инфу. Если сейчас MSFN не в дауне, то можно посмотреть по этой ссылке:
http://www.msfn.org/board/index.php?act=ST&f=80&t=31407